Tex: My numbers will be there
Through 41 games, Mark Teixeira is batting just .226 with 5 home runs and 20 RBIs. His slugging percentage is a mere .384, lower than every Yankee regular other than Russell Martin. Simple arithmetic says that at this pace, Teixeira will end up with about 20 home runs and 80 RBIs for 2012, the worst numbers of his career. Tarp is off, and the lines are on
The rain has stopped and it looks like the game will start on or close to the scheduled time of 7:08 first pitch. The grounds crew is putting down the foul lines and batter’s boxes and some of the Royals are on the field warming up, so it looks like we will at least see the start of a ballgame tonight.
